As I sifted through vibrant spices in my kitchen, an aroma wafted through the air, transporting me to sunny Jamaica. This Vegan Jamaican Sweet Potato Pudding is more than just a dessert; it’s a piece of home that resonates with love and carefree laughter, while also being gluten-free! This pudding, wonderfully moist and sweetened with creamy coconut milk, offers a delightful balance of sweet and savory warmth that’s hard to resist. Whether you’re embarking on a culinary adventure or seeking a comforting staple, this recipe caters to a variety of diets and satisfies cravings without the guilt. Plus, it’s quick to prepare—perfect for busy evenings or spontaneous gatherings. Curious about the secret behind that luxurious texture? Let’s jump into the delicious details!

Why is this Vegan Sweet Potato Pudding special?
Decadently moist: This pudding melts in your mouth, offering a comforting experience that hugs your taste buds.
Rich tropical flavor: Sweet coconut milk and warm spices create a delightful harmony, reminiscent of island bliss.
Easily adaptable: Swap ingredients to make this dish your own—dairy-free, gluten-free, and perfect for all diets!
Time-saving delight: Prepare it in just a few simple steps, freeing up your time for more enjoyment.
Crowd-pleaser: Serve this enchanting dessert at gatherings and watch it disappear quickly, leaving everyone wanting more! Consider pairing it with some Baked Sweet Potatoes for an even more satisfying meal.
Vegan Sweet Potato Pudding Ingredients
For the Pudding
- Sweet Potato – A key ingredient that provides the moisture and natural sweetness; opt for white-fleshed sweet potatoes, commonly known as batata.
- Coconut Milk – Adds a creamy richness to the pudding; you can substitute it with any plant-based milk for a different taste.
- Coconut Palm Sugar – This sweetener gives a lovely caramel note; brown sugar works well as an alternative for a richer flavor.
- Fresh Ginger – Imparts a warm, spicy kick; feel free to omit it for a milder taste.
- Vanilla Extract – Elevates the dessert’s sweetness and depth; using pure vanilla extract yields the best results.
- Gluten-Free All-Purpose Flour – Provides necessary structure to the pudding; regular all-purpose flour can be used for those not gluten-sensitive.
- Optional Spices – Cinnamon and nutmeg enhance the dish’s flavor; adjust according to your preference.
- Sea Salt – Balances out the sweetness; kosher salt is a fine substitute.
For the Custard Topping
- Coconut Milk – Use the remaining coconut milk for a luscious topping; a hint of vanilla in this mixture ties everything together.
- Coconut Palm Sugar – Sweetens the custard topping harmoniously; feel free to adjust the quantity for desired sweetness.
- Cinnamon – A dash adds warmth and complements the other flavors; use sparingly or to taste.
Dive into this Vegan Sweet Potato Pudding recipe and discover how each ingredient works together to create a mouthwatering dessert that everyone will adore!
Step‑by‑Step Instructions for Vegan Sweet Potato Pudding
Step 1: Preheat the Oven and Prepare the Pan
Begin by preheating your oven to 375°F (190°C). While the oven warms up, get a 9-inch round baking pan and generously grease it with a bit of coconut oil or non-stick spray. This will prevent your Vegan Sweet Potato Pudding from sticking to the sides and ensure a smooth release after baking.
Step 2: Prepare the Sweet Potatoes
Next, peel and chop the sweet potatoes into smaller chunks to make grating easier. Using a food processor, grate the sweet potatoes until they reach a smooth, uniform texture. This step is crucial for achieving the luxurious consistency of your pudding. Set the grated sweet potatoes aside as we mix the rest of the ingredients.
Step 3: Mix the Batter
In a large mixing bowl, combine the grated sweet potatoes with the creamy coconut milk, coconut palm sugar, fresh ginger, vanilla extract, and a pinch of sea salt. Stir everything together until it forms a luscious mixture, ensuring all ingredients are well incorporated and smooth. The warm, vibrant colors of the batter will get you excited for the baking process ahead!
Step 4: Incorporate the Flour
Gradually add in the gluten-free all-purpose flour, folding it into the sweet potato mixture. Use a spatula or wooden spoon to mix until the batter is smooth and slightly thickens. This part is essential to give the Vegan Sweet Potato Pudding the right structure. You’re creating a delightful blend that will soon transform into a mouthwatering dessert.
Step 5: Bake the Pudding
Pour the batter into your prepared baking pan, spreading it evenly. Place the pan in the preheated oven and bake for about 45 minutes. You’ll know it’s ready when the edges are set, and the center feels firm to the touch. A delightful aroma will fill your kitchen, hinting at the tropical flavors awaiting you!
Step 6: Prepare the Custard Topping
While your pudding bakes, pull together the custard topping. In a mixing bowl, combine the remaining coconut milk, coconut palm sugar, vanilla extract, and a sprinkle of cinnamon. Whisk until smooth. This topping will create a sweet, rich layer that contrasts beautifully with the tender pudding below, adding an extra touch of indulgence.
Step 7: Add the Topping and Bake Again
After the first baking period, carefully remove the pudding from the oven and pour the custard mixture evenly over the top. Return the pudding to the oven for another 45 minutes, allowing the custard to set. You’ll know it’s done when the top is golden brown and firm, creating a delightful crust atop your Vegan Sweet Potato Pudding.
Step 8: Cool and Serve
Once baked, remove the pudding from the oven and let it cool for at least 10 minutes before slicing. This resting period allows the pudding to firm up further while allowing those wonderful flavors to meld. Serve warm, and perhaps add a dollop of coconut whipped cream for a truly indulgent experience. Enjoy the delicious journey of your Vegan Sweet Potato Pudding!

Expert Tips for Vegan Sweet Potato Pudding
-
Grating Sweet Potatoes: Ensure the sweet potatoes are finely grated to avoid any chunky texture in your pudding; this creates a smoother and creamier result.
-
Flour Substitution: If using American sweet potatoes, consider doubling the amount of flour for a better texture, ensuring your Vegan Sweet Potato Pudding maintains its stability and shape.
-
Serve Warm: For optimal flavor and softness, serve your pudding warm. You can enhance it further with a dollop of coconut whipped cream for extra indulgence.
-
Flavor Variations: Experiment with different non-dairy milks to vary the flavor profile of the pudding, making it your own while keeping it vegan-friendly.
-
Storage Tips: Leftovers can be stored in an airtight container at room temperature for 1-2 days. For longer storage, refrigerate or freeze the pudding to enjoy later.
Make Ahead Options
These Vegan Jamaican Sweet Potato Pudding preparations are ideal for busy cooks looking to streamline mealtime! You can prep the sweet potato mixture up to 24 hours in advance; simply combine the grated sweet potatoes, coconut milk, coconut palm sugar, ginger, vanilla, and salt in a bowl, and refrigerate until you’re ready to bake. The topping can also be prepared in advance and stored in the fridge. When you’re ready to finish the pudding, mix in the flour, pour the batter into your pan, bake it for the initial 45 minutes, add the custard topping, and then bake for another 45 minutes. Why save time? Because you deserve a delicious, hassle-free dessert that’s just as delightful the next day!
Vegan Sweet Potato Pudding Variations
Feel free to explore your creativity and customize this delicious pudding to suit your taste preferences!
- Plant-Based Milk: Substitute coconut milk with almond or oat milk for different flavor profiles; enjoy a new twist each time.
- Sweetener Choices: Use maple syrup or agave for a different sweetness; each will lend its own unique flavor to the pudding.
- Fruit Add-Ins: Incorporate dried fruits like sultanas or raisins for bursts of natural sweetness and added texture; they blend beautifully with the pudding.
- Heat Level: Add a pinch of cayenne or chili powder for a spicy kick; it creates an intriguing contrast to the sweetness.
- Nutty Delight: Top with chopped toasted pecans or walnuts for crunch; it enhances both flavor and texture with delightful nutty goodness.
- Spice Variations: Experiment with cardamom or allspice instead of cinnamon; these spices bring a warm, exotic twist to each bite.
- Chocolate Lovers: Stir in cacao nibs or chocolate chips into the batter before baking for a decadent chocolatey infusion; it’s a heavenly combo with sweet potatoes!
Why not pair your Vegan Sweet Potato Pudding with some delightful Cranberry Apple Sweet Potatoes to create a vibrant dessert platter that sparks joy? Enjoy these amazing options while making this recipe your own!
What to Serve with Vegan Jamaican Sweet Potato Pudding
Indulging in this sweet and creamy delight opens the door to delightful meal pairings that complement its tropical flavors.
-
Stew Peas: This rich, savory dish made with beans and spices brings a wonderful contrast to the sweetness, creating a well-rounded meal. Its depth makes it a perfect companion for the pudding.
-
Jamaican Rice and Peas: A classic side full of coconut flavor that mirrors the pudding, it adds a comforting, hearty component to your dessert spread. Plus, its vibrant colors are a feast for the eyes.
-
Fresh Tropical Fruit Salad: A refreshing combination of fruits like mango, pineapple, and papaya adds a zesty brightness, making every bite a burst of sunshine alongside the creamy pudding.
-
Coconut Whipped Cream: Elevate your pudding further by topping it with this airy, creamy delight. The additional coconut notes enhance the overall experience while offering a luxurious touch.
-
Herbal Tea or Hibiscus Iced Tea: A soothing herbal tea or a vibrant hibiscus iced tea provides a refreshing sip that cleanses the palate after enjoying the sweet pudding, balancing the meal perfectly.
-
Rum Cake: For a festive touch, serve this traditional Jamaican cake alongside your pudding. Its rich flavors and slightly boozy notes pair beautifully with the sweet potato dessert.
Creating a full meal around your Vegan Jamaican Sweet Potato Pudding is a breeze; each of these suggestions brings unique flavors and textures that will keep your guests coming back for more!
Storage Tips for Vegan Sweet Potato Pudding
Room Temperature: Store leftovers in an airtight container for up to 2 days, ensuring the pudding remains moist and delicious.
Fridge: If not consumed within 2 days, refrigerate your Vegan Sweet Potato Pudding to maintain freshness for up to 1 week.
Freezer: For longer storage, freeze the pudding in an airtight container for up to 2 months. Thaw in the fridge overnight before reheating.
Reheating: Warm individual portions in the microwave for about 30-60 seconds, or reheat in the oven at 350°F (175°C) until heated through.

Vegan Jamaican Sweet Potato Pudding Recipe FAQs
What type of sweet potatoes should I use?
Absolutely! For the best results, opt for white-fleshed sweet potatoes, also known as batata. These provide the ideal moisture and natural sweetness for your Vegan Jamaican Sweet Potato Pudding. Look for sweet potatoes that are firm and free from dark spots or blemishes.
How should I store the Vegan Sweet Potato Pudding?
Very good question! If you have leftovers, store them in an airtight container at room temperature for up to 2 days. For longer freshness, refrigerate the pudding, where it will last for up to 1 week. This will help maintain its lovely texture and sweetness.
Can I freeze leftover Vegan Sweet Potato Pudding?
Absolutely! You can freeze the pudding for up to 2 months. Just make sure to place it in an airtight container or wrap it well. When you’re ready to enjoy it again, simply thaw it in the fridge overnight, then reheat in the microwave or oven to bring back that delightful warmth.
What if my pudding turns out too dense or chunky?
Great question! If your Vegan Sweet Potato Pudding ends up too dense, it could be due to not grating the sweet potatoes finely enough. To prevent this, use a food processor for a smooth texture. Additionally, ensure that the flour is folded in gradually to avoid over-mixing, which can lead to a denser result.
Is this pudding suitable for those with allergies?
It sure is! This recipe is vegan and can easily be made gluten-free by using gluten-free all-purpose flour. However, always check for any specific allergens in your ingredient labels, especially if someone in your household has nut allergies, as certain plant-based milks might contain traces of nuts.
Can I customize the flavors of the pudding?
The more the merrier! Feel free to experiment by adding spices like cinnamon or nutmeg according to your taste preference. You can also swap coconut milk with other plant-based milk like almond or cashew milk for a twist on flavor, making it truly your own!

Irresistible Vegan Sweet Potato Pudding Made Easy
Ingredients
Equipment
Method
- Preheat your oven to 375°F (190°C) and grease a 9-inch round baking pan.
- Peel and chop the sweet potatoes into smaller chunks and grate them using a food processor until smooth.
- In a mixing bowl, combine the grated sweet potatoes with coconut milk, coconut palm sugar, ginger, vanilla extract, and sea salt. Stir until smooth.
- Gradually add gluten-free flour to the mixture and fold until the batter is smooth and slightly thickened.
- Pour the batter into the prepared pan and bake for about 45 minutes until the edges are set.
- Combine remaining coconut milk, coconut palm sugar, and cinnamon in a mixing bowl and whisk until smooth.
- Pour the custard mixture over the pudding and bake for another 45 minutes until the top is golden brown.
- Let the pudding cool for at least 10 minutes before slicing. Serve warm, optionally with coconut whipped cream.

Leave a Reply